uPVC Windows Repairs Near Me

uPVC is a great option for any home. They are secure, affordable to maintain, and offer excellent insulation. However, they could be susceptible to damage and require repair at times.

Maintain your uPVC window in good working order by regular cleaning using soap and water. Also, you should clean the frames to prevent dirt accumulating.

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gCracked glass

A cracked window can be unsightly and cause energy loss. It can also allow allergens and pests to enter your home. Fortunately, the majority of cracked glass can be repaired by a qualified repair service. The most important thing to keep in mind is that it's always better to get cracks in your windows repaired sooner rather than later. The longer a crack is left untreated, the more damage it could cause to your window and door glass.

Fortunately, most cracks in your window can be repaired with two-part epoxy. The type of epoxy you choose to use will depend on the severity of the crack and the location of the crack. This method can be used to repair picture glass windows with single panes, and even kitchen glassware. This method can be utilized to repair cracks in glass tile and mirrors. The most important thing to do for an effective repair is to make sure that the crack doesn't contain sharp edges. You should also avoid using superglue as this is not a durable solution and could cause further damage to the glass.

It is crucial to read the instructions thoroughly when working with epoxy. You will typically need to mix resin and hardener in a ratio of 50/50. This mixture is then sprayed to the glass with a putty knife. You should only apply small amounts of epoxy at a given time and be careful not to overwork it. Once the epoxy has been applied, it needs to cure for about a day. You can accelerate the curing process by putting the heat source, such as a blow dryer on the affected area.

Stress cracks are the most popular kind of cracked glass. They are caused by a sudden change in pressure, such as from weather fluctuations. These cracks have a typical hourglass shape.

Cracks in the glass are often more apparent and result from physical impact. A pebble from your lawnmowers' hose or the ball that your kids throw at you can easily break glass. If a window is damaged by an impact crack, it's recommended to replace the entire window pane instead of attempting to repair it.

Window Leaks

Window leaks are a typical problem that usually occurs during rainy seasons. If not dealt with in time, it can cause severe water damage to your house. This is because moisture can damage the materials that surround the window frame and sill which causes them to swell or even crack. This can also lead to mildew and mold, which can be harmful for you and your family. Therefore, you must examine the condition of your windows on a regular basis and schedule a repair whenever you need to.

The majority of window leaks are due to maintenance issues, such as caulking which has worn out or been broken, rotting wooden frames near the windows, or paint that has cracked or bubbled. These are all simple to repair and shouldn't cost any money. If the problem is more severe it may be necessary to replace your windows.

It is recommended to begin by cleaning thoroughly to ensure that the frame's surrounding area the frame is clean. You can accomplish this using an apron hanger that is wire to get rid of dirt and debris from weep holes on the bottom of the frame. Then, you need to apply a fresh caulking layer. Make sure to remove the old caulking first before you apply the new one. This step is crucial as it ensures that the new caulking won't get displaced by caulking that was previously used.

After you've finished this, you should let the caulk dry before you can use your window. Follow the directions on the package to achieve the best result. Paint the frame, if required.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ines when doing this to make sure you don't harm your window.

Examine the walls for signs that they could be leaky. It is possible that the problem is not with your window repair near me but with the wall. To prevent this, you should check the walls for cracks, and then reseal them if necessary. You should also ensure that the overhang and sill are angled properly to prevent water from your windows. Also, you must check for damaged flashing and sealant.

Damaged Frames

If the frame of a window has been damaged, it needs to be repaired by a professional. This repair is sometimes referred to a "framing" job. It can be completed with glue or putty dependent on the extent and nature of the damage. In addition, a professional can also repair or replace parts of the window to stop further damage.

Frames made of wood can rot and split over time. They must be replaced if this happens. The cost of replacing a wooden frame could vary depending on the type and design of wood. For instance, a pine model is less expensive than an oak unit.

Aluminum windows are a popular choice for homeowners due to their attractive appearance and are less expensive to maintain than wood. However, they can also rust and develop cracks as time passes. When this happens the replacement is usually needed. They are also not as efficient in energy use as wooden ones.

Vinyl models may break and crack over time, and the seals can become damaged. This can result in air and water leaking into the home, which can cause issues with moisture. The majority of cracks can be repaired with adhesive or putty. Broken Hinges

If your window hinges have broken there is a possibility that the holes in which they are screwed into aren't fully drilled. If this is the case, a simple solution will help you avoid having to buy and install new hinges. You can simply go to your local hardware shop and purchase wood dowels of the same diameter as your existing screw heads. Then, place them into the hinge holes on both sides of the jamb. Fill the holes with wood filler and dowels and then put in new hinges.

If the problem is simply that the screws are loose, then this should be a relatively easy fix. Make sure that you tighten them up so they are securely seated in the screw holes. If the screws are damaged or the screw holes are damaged however, this will be more difficult to fix at home.

A common issue with windows made of upvc is that, over time the glass can crack or become slightly chipped. This is a temporary fix that can be made with glue or putty. This will prevent the glass from further cracking and, possibly, shattering.
